Britain’s intelligence on capture of Russia Severodonetsk: This is a significant success

Britain’s intelligence evaluates the seizure of Severodonetsk by the Russian army as a significant achievement, but notes that this is only one of many tasks in the declared goal of Russia to reach the boundaries of the Lugansk and Donetsk regions. This is stated in the British intelligence review for June 26th.

According to them, most Ukrainian military, most likely, left defensive positions in Severodonetsk.

“The capture of the city by Russia is a significant success within the framework of its reduced goals of the war (entering the borders of the Donetsk and Lugansk regions). This is an important industrial center and it has a strategic location in the Seversky Donets. However, this is only one of a number of difficult tasks that Russia that Russia We’ll have to carry out to capture the entire Donbass. This, including the attack on Kramatorsk and maintaining the main supplies in Donetsk, ”British intelligence notes.
